      Overview

      The eFX Production Support Engineer will act as a profession in the Global FX production team, providing front line support to the electronic trading business, sales community, and external clients, where you will be expected to balance between fast response (e.g., electronic trading monitoring and incident management) and longer-term activities (e.g., DevOps, release planning, security, and audit reviews).

      Working in Production means you'll use both creative and critical thinking skills to maintain application systems that are crucial to the daily operations of the Firm. You'll work collaboratively in teams on a wide range of projects based on your primary area of focus. While learning to fix application and data issues as they arise, you'll also gain exposure to software development, testing, deployment, maintenance, and improvement, in addition to production lifecycle methodologies and risk guidelines.       What You’ll Do

      • Act as a Production Support engineer in the Global Foreign Exchange production team, providing first and second level support to the Trading, Sales, and business community for the suite of applications and their associated components

      • Management and communication of major production incidents

      • Tooling improvements, automation, and reduction of manual effort

      • Work closely with application development and infrastructure teams to fix issues and to improve the stability and performance of the environment

      • Act as the prime liaison for the application suite into the incident, problem, change, release, capacity, and continuity functions

      • Application rollout activities (may include some weekend activities)

      Skills You’ll Need

      • Minimum academic requirement: Bachelor’s degree in a technical subject or equivalent experience

      • Basic knowledge of application development lifecycle

      • Familiarity with production management best practices i.e., capacity management, incident management, change management

      • Linux proficiency

      • Proactive, self-starter mindset - ability to take ownership of major issues, projects, and critical electronic trading systems

      Skills That Will Help You Excel

      • Experience in front office trading technology, preferably FX

      • Understand business fundamentals of Fixed Income & Currencies (FIC) electronic trading including FX (spot, forwards), Rates

      • Hands on deployment experience

      • Programming or scripting language

      • Useful technical skills: KDB, Structured Query Language (SQL), FIX, network fundamentals, ECN connectivity, colocation related technologies, Python
